## Authentication

The Rankloft relevance-tuning notes are stored behind the internal Notesmith API. New team members need a key to pull tuning experiments, judged query sets, and historical boost configurations. Read access is enough for day-to-day work; write access requires a separate request. The shared read key is listed below.

gateway credential: kto23_LX9A4ys6i4nzHtpOLNLodKK

Subject: Dependency pinning — read before your first shift

Welcome to the Larkspur on-call rotation. Quick rule: every service pins exact versions, no ranges, no floating tags. If a build pulls an unpinned dep, the Fenwick gate blocks the deploy — don't override it without a waiver from the platform lead. Lockfile updates go through the weekly batch, not hotfixes. Full policy and exception process are on the internal page below.

wiki page, bawef-hafop: https://jira.nelvroworks.corp/job/pages/projects/7c5c0f440dbd

## Quornbus Broker Upgrade — Step 4 of 9

Before draining the Quornbus cluster, confirm that both replica nodes in the Velden Park datacenter report a healthy quorum. Run the drain script only after the Marlowe dashboard shows zero in-flight messages; skipping this check has caused duplicate deliveries in past upgrades. Once drained, stop the broker service, apply the 4.2 package, and restart. To re-register the upgraded node with the Tillhouse coordination service, authenticate using the key below.

API key for yahig-tadup: kto7_ubizbYm

Welcome to the Scrubjay team! Scrubjay is our orphaned-resource sweeper — it finds dangling volumes and unattached IPs left behind after releases. As release manager, you'll kick off a sweep after every deploy. It authenticates against the Tidewell internal API, nothing fancy. For your first run, use the shared staging credential, which is right below.

gateway credential: kto3_qfe